CVE-2024-8434: Easy Mega Menu Plugin for WordPress – ThemeHunk <= 1.0.9 - Missing Authorization to Authenticated (Subscriber+) Settings Updates

What the vulnerability does

01Description

The Easy Mega Menu Plugin for WordPress – ThemeHunk pl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to unauthorized access due to a missing capability check on several functions hooked via AJAX in all versions up to, and including, 1.0.9. This makes it possible for authenticated attackers, with subscriber-level access and above, to perform actions like updating plugin settings.
